Almaty: On Jan 9, Kazakhstan authorities proclaimed that they had settled the situation across the country after the pernicious outbreak of violence in 30 years of independence. “A number of strategic facilities have been transferred under the protection of the united peacekeeping contingent of the CSTO member states,” the presidential office statement said. Over the past week, dozens of people have been killed, thousands detained and public buildings were torched.
